Output 5f2556129a332893855e82c203eb5e97f27279391360dcbccbf12a211e4c6ab1:0

value
2678062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 039e0f853122e90e29b1b3a591de05962fd3e1a2 OP_EQUALVERIFY OP_CHECKSIG
address
1L8Npaa6fdUgg7GWHFjJuTYjFhSzeoxUs
transaction
5f2556129a332893855e82c203eb5e97f27279391360dcbccbf12a211e4c6ab1
spent
true